Hello, My work as a Chaplain, Grief and Trauma Counselor is accompanying individuals in their moments of challenge. I also provide training and praxis for the journey towards establishing healthy boundaries, social emotional coping strategies to implement a self care practice which nurtures self-awareness to provide better de-escalation skills and embodiment practices. My name is Beyssa Buil and I was born and raised in the "305" or commonly known as Miami, Florida. I am a person on the Autism Spectrum living with Multiple Sclerosis. I am an endorsed Chaplain, disability rights advocate, environmental/social justice activist and community organizer. I serve as the Community Minister for All Souls Miami a Unitarian Universalist Congregation. I serve on several boards and part of various coalitions, past and present to include Professional Advisory Group for Jackson Memorial Hospital, National Coalition for the Homeless, Southern Coalition for Social Justice, The Climate Reality Project, Autistic Self Advocacy Network, SMASH Miami, UU for Social Justice, Miami Climate Alliance & Shut Down Glades Coalition. |
